> I've got BackupPC running and backing up linux boxes fine.  I'm now
> trying to back up a Windows 2003 box.  I've got the SMB shared out and
> now want to set the password in backuppc but just want to do it for this
> host.  So I went searching for the CONFDIR/pc/ subdir and couldn't find
> it.  All I can find is my TOPDIR/pc/ subdir.
>
> Any idea what I'm missing here?

I'm not sure the per-pc config files are created unless there are
non-default values for them.   Why don't you use the web interface for
these settings?
